A pair of area softball teams settled for state runner-up trophies at the WIAA State Softball Tournament on Saturday at the Goodman Diamond in Madison.
In Division Five, Oakfield dropped a 4-3 decision in eight innings to Stevens Point Paceli. Oakfield finishes the season at 22-4. This was Oakfield’s 17th trip to the WIAA State Softball Tournament. This was their fifth runner up to go along with their six state title.
In Division Three, Laconia fell to Prescott 3-1. This was the Spartans sixth appearance at state, making it to the title game every time. It’s their third runner-up trophy, with 2nd place finishes in 2014 and 2009. They took come gold three straight seasons in 2015, 2016, and 2017.
